Abstract :
We investigate searching ability finding local minima and the global minimum in a given traveling salesman problem (TSP) by using the Hopfield neural network with stochastic noise sources composed of various time series. Firstly we tune the network up by changing parameters of a 2-state Gilbert model noise source whose time series looks like an intermittency chaos. As a result, the solving ability cannot be improved drastically by changing such parameters. Secondly, we propose two noise sources; a noise generated by switching two different periodic motions, a noise generated by m-state Gilbert model with different periodic motions. From the numerical experiments, we can conclude that the periodic behavior and its stochastical. switching is rather essential as an effective noise for TSP
